Abstract

1401016 Breaking open film cartridges EASTMAN KODAK CO 8 Sept 1972 [9 Sept 1971] 41868/72 Heading G2X A device for breaking open film cartridges 1 has means for supporting the take-up chamber 7 so as to prevent movement in at least one direction, and also for forcing the remainder of the cartridge in the same direction so that it fractures. As shown, the device is mounted on a vertical plate 13. A plate 17 carrying a tapered spindle 24 is secured to plate 13 by pins 18, 19, 20 but spaced therefrom by spacers 21, 22, 23. Spindle 24 fits into a similarly-shaped recess 25 in the take-up chamber 7, see also Fig. 2 (not shown), rotation of chamber 7 on the spool being limited by stops 27, 28. A guide arm 15 can pivot on a pin 31 secured to plate 17, and is urged anticlockwise by a spring 32 against a stop 36 on plate 17. In loading a cartridge into the device, the take-up chamber 7 is slid along a guide surface 33 extending from arm 15 until it seats on spindle 24, and is retained there by an offset portion 40 of guide 33. Such loading can conveniently be carried out under darkroom conditions. A breaker lever 16 having a handle 44 is also pivoted on pin 31, and is urged in a clockwise direction by a spring 41, the spring having arms 42, 43 abutted respectively against the under-side of handle 44 and a backstop wall 45 of plate 17. Lever 16 includes an offset portion 46 and a bumper 47, and in the rest position bumper 47 abuts against backstop wall 45, When the cartridge is mounted on the device, handle 44 and hence lever 16 is pivoted anti-clockwise, so that a blade 49 and jaw 50 come into contact respectively with the central part 8 and the supply chamber 5 of the cartridge. The whole cartridge is thus pivoted anti-clockwise on spindle 24 until a shoulder extension 29 on chamber 7 abuts against stop 27, so that chamber 7 can rotate no further. If rotation of lever 16 is still continued further, then the cartridge is fractured, and parts 8 and 5 broken away from chamber 7, so that the film can now be extracted (Fig. 6). A shield 53 protects the operator against any flying fragments.
